Drop in here a scalar grid channel to define the viscosity of the liquid given in kg/ms variably. The values in this channel should all be >= 0.0. You can use the Candidate button to find or create channels that fit into this field. 
<br></br>
If this link is not provided the Global Viscosity value is used instead.
